Output 6df5f59523bdc05b0d33702a0586de55968e25ee864657e4c10df8be4c59c97e:21

value
8970164
script pubkey
OP_0 OP_PUSHBYTES_20 5f2cb8a38d53e7deb8e95dc0d500c72d1c7c3b28
address
bc1qtukt3gud20naaw8fthqd2qx895w8cwegr62nnp
transaction
6df5f59523bdc05b0d33702a0586de55968e25ee864657e4c10df8be4c59c97e
confirmations
184634
spent
true